Title :
Radiation of a charge passing from vacuum into the left-handed medium

Abstract :
We analyse the problem with a charge intersecting the interface between ordinary medium and “left-handed” one. Both the case of semi-infinite media and the case of a cylindrical waveguide are considered. We describe exact and asymptotic approaches for investigation of the electromagnetic field. We note features of spatial radiation due to unusual properties of “left-handed” medium. In particular, the effect of “reversed Cherenkov-transition radiation” (RCTR) is demonstrated both analytically and numerically.
